There are many bad habits that can cause children’s malocclusion, parents, kindergarten and school teachers should have an understanding of them, which is important for the prevention of children’s malocclusion. 1, finger sucking habits: lead to open jaw deformity and arch narrowing, palate cover high arch, upper front teeth protruding, open lips and teeth and far in the wrong jaw and other deformities, fingers can also appear callus and finger bending. 2, bad tongue habits: can form the front teeth part of the open jaw; lick tongue habits can make the front teeth to the lip side tilt, and gap; tongue habits easily caused by the front teeth open jaw and jaw protrusion deformity. 3, bad biting lower lip habits: can cause upper front teeth lip to tilt and interdental gap, lower front teeth tongue side tilt and crowded, facial manifestations of open lips and teeth, upper front teeth protruding and lower front teeth shrinkage, etc.; and biting the upper lip habits are prone to the formation of mandibular protrusion, anterior anti-mandibular (Baotian) and other deformities. 4. Biting habit: small open jaws can be formed in specific parts of the dental arch. 5, open-mouth breathing habits: can cause the upper arch narrow, palate cover high arch, maxillary teeth protruding or crowded teeth, and even lead to open lips and teeth, gums hypertrophy and hyperplasia, bleeding gums. Experts remind: early correction of children’s oral bad habits, can play an effective preventive role in malocclusion.
